ARTICLE SNIPPET: “Palestinian militants in the Gaza Strip fired six consecutive rockets at the northern Negev city of Ashkelon on Thursday morning. A few minutes later, three rockets struck Sdot Hanegev regional council, closer to the Hamas-ruled coastal territory.
Three of which exploded in residential areas of Ashkelon. A woman was lightly wounded by shrapnel in one of the incidents and several people were treated for shock.
The rockets struck multiple locations in the city just before 8 A.M., one apparently scoring a direct hit on a house. Three other rockets exploded in areas outside of the city.

Israel Air Force jets struck 20 targets in Gaza overnight, including a mosque in the northern Gaza neighborhood of Jabalya, believed to be a terror hub.
The IDF said that the bombing of the mosque triggered a series of explosions, indicative of the amounts of weapons stored on the premises. (Ynet)

ARTICLE SNIPPET: “(IsraelNN.com) The defense establishment increased its level of alert on Thursday evening after receiving more than 60 warnings of planned attacks. The unusually high level of threats appears to be connected to the assassination of senior Hamas terrorist Nizar Rayyan in Gaza earlier in the day.”

ARTICLE SNIPPET: “Hundreds of foreign nationals residing in Gaza left the Strip early Friday morning en route to their countries of origin.
Some 250 foreigners, mostly women married to Palestinian citizens and a small group of representatives of international organizations have left Gaza in coordination with the Red Cross and the diplomatic missions in Israel.”

ARTICLE SNIPPET: “One of them, Ziad Abu Ein, a deputy minister in the PA, called on Hamas to return the weapons it had confiscated from Fatah members in the Gaza Strip so they could help in fighting against the IDF during a ground offensive.
Abu Ein said Fatah had about 70,000 loyalists in the Gaza Strip, many of them former members of the PA security forces, who were prepared to repel an Israeli incursion.
Meanwhile, a senior aide to PA President Mahmoud Abbas launched a scathing attack on Hamas and accused it of being a puppet in the hands of Iran.”

Jordanian Diplomats Have Left Iran
According to official Iranian sources, all the Jordanian diplomats have left Iran, following an ultimatum given to the heads of the Egyptian and Jordanian embassies in Tehran to either condemn the Israeli offensive in Gaza or leave the country.
